The Expert Panel on Skills was established on September 18th, 1998, by the Advisory Council on Science and Technology (ACST), to advise on critical skills knowledge-intensive industrial sectors. The Panel provides independent, expert advice on the critical skills needed in a number of sectors of industry where Canada is strong already or where opportunities for economic growth and for job creation are high. These sectors are: aerospace, automotive, bio-pharmaceuticals and bio-technologies in agriculture, aquaculture and forestry, environmental technologies, and information and telecommunications technologies.

Le Conseil consultatif des sciences et de la technologie (CCST) a annoncé la création du Groupe d'experts sur les compétences, le 8 septembre 1998. Ce Groupe fournira des avis éclairés et indépendants sur les compétences requises dans un certain nombre de secteurs industriels qui sont déjà en bonne position concurrentielle ou dont le potentiel de croissance et de création d'emplois est élevé. Ces secteurs sont : l'aérospatiale; l'automobile; la biopharmaceutique et les biotechnologies dans les domaines de l'agriculture, de l'aquiculture et de la foresterie; les technologies environnementales; et les technologies de l'information et des télécommunications.
